Case series on phyllodes tumour of breast in young females: Unusual clinico-radiological presentations in unusual age group—Thinking beyond fibroadenomas!
Abstract Background Phyllodes tumours (PT) of the breast are rare primary breast neoplasms, mostly seen in fourth to fifth decades of life.
